Luminescence of a Pt(ii) complex in the presence of DNA. Dependence of luminescence changes on the interaction binding mode.

- Luminescence intensity changes of a Pt(ii) complex which is known to bind externally to DNA at low [DNA]/[complex] ratio and to intercalate at high [DNA]/[complex] ratio are studied in the presence of calf thymus DNA. External binding is demonstrated to induce luminescence enhancement whereas intercalation leads to luminescence quenching. The reasons for this behaviour are discussed. [ABSTRACT FROM AUTHOR]
